What are some characteristics of japenese ukiyo-e woodblock prints
mafiozo [28]

There should be options to choose from for this question. I managed to find them elsewhere. The options are:

A: They have symmetrical balance and detailed forms.

B: They have highly textured details and lots of colors.

C: They have ambiguous space and cropped forms.

D: They have lots of patterns and objects centered on the paper.

The correct answer is B. Japanese ukiyo-e woodblock prints have highly textured details and lots of color. The woodblock prints usually depicted landscapes, tales from history, scenes from the Kabuki theatre, as well as courtesans, geisha and other aspects of everyday city life. Ukiyo-e became the dominant art movement in Japan during the 17th century, where it was appreciated above all as a colorful form of decorative art.

What are the companies called that collect, edit, duplicate, and distribute printed music?
Mekhanik [1.2K]

The Music Industry is containing and composing of not only companies but also individuals that making money by writing new pieces of songs, selling live shows and concerts, audio and video recordings and compositions of sheet music. These people called songwriters and composers, musicians, recorders, bandleaders, publishers, and producers, and etc.


But the companies that will be going to create, produce and distribute its musical scores are the  Music Publishing companies.
